Walk-In || Machine Learning Engineer – AI Search
Eastern Book Company
Job description
About Eastern Book Compnay The EBC Group is India's Largest Legal Information Technology (IT) Provider - in Print, Desktop and Portable Devices. We are one of the most recognised legal-technology brands in the country on a mission to provide very high quality information and technology solutions to our customers. EBC has many first innovations in this sector, including India’s largest legal ecommerce platform, the EBC Webstore; the EBC Reader, India's most advanced legal eLibrary and EBC Learning, an online learning platform. With branches in over 8 Indian cities, the company is the publisher of India’s leading law report, Supreme Court Cases and the SCC Online range of databases. Headed by professionals from the top business and law schools, we require individuals for leading this exciting phase of growth. You can view the detailed company profile on www.ebc.co.in. For more details, please see https://ebclearning.com/ Role Overview As a ML Engineer at EBC, you will play a important role in building the next generation of AI-powered legal research tools. Your mission is to contribute for the development of intelligent, conversational legal search experiences by leveraging retrieval-augmented generation (RAG), fine-tuned LLMs, and real-time vector-based search technologies. You’ll collaborate closely with the engineering teams to ingest and structure legal data, build AI models, and integrate them into user-facing applications within the EBC Reader platform. Key Responsibilities: 1. AI-Based Search & Retrieval
- Build and optimize RAG-based pipelines using LLMs like GPT-4 , LLaMA etc.
- Fine-tune large language models for domain-specific (legal) use cases.
- Improve search ranking and result quality through continuous feedback loops and testing.
- Contribute in design and implementation of AI-driven search systems for legal content 2. Data Processing & Vector Indexing
- Create pipelines to ingest, clean, chunk, and vectorize complex legal documents (case law, statutes, treatises).
- Maintain indexes in vector databases (e.g., Qdrant, FAISS, Pinecone).
- Support weekly data updates to ensure relevancy of legal content. 3. Model Deployment & Infrastructure
- Deploy and maintain production-ready ML models using cloud infrastructure (preferably AWS).
- Develop REST APIs (Fast API or Flask) for seamless integration into frontend apps.
- Monitor model latency, reliability, and scalability in real-time. 4. Product Collaboration
- Work closely with product managers, backend developers, and UX teams to ship AI-powered features.
- Participate in technical reviews and influence system design decisions around AI integration.
- Implement observability tools to track model behaviour, performance, and telemetry data. Tech Stack
- ML/NLP: Python, TensorFlow/ PyTorch, Hugging Face models and APIs
- Vector Search: Qdrant , FAISS, Pinecone, Elastic search
- Deployment: AWS Services, like Bedrock , Personalise etc
- Data Tools: Pandas, NumPy, Scikit-learn , Matplot lib ,spaCy, NLTK
- APIs: REST APIs built with Fast API or Flask Required Skills & Experience
- 2+ years in machine learning, NLP, or AI-powered search systems
- Strong understanding of embeddings, vector search, and RAG architectures
- Proven experience deploying and maintaining ML models in production environments
- Experience with legal, document-heavy datasets a strong plus
- Experience with product search ranking algorithms, personalization engines, or content-based filtering.
- Good understanding of recommendation systems (collaborative filtering, matrix factorization, hybrid models).
- Experience in deploying models using Fast API, Flask, or Lambda functions Nice to Have
- Background in legal tech or contract/document analysis
- Experience with product search ranking algorithms, personalization engines, or content-based filtering.
- Familiarity with vector databases (e.g., Qdrant ,FAISS, Pinecone, OpenSearch) for similarity search.
- Experience in deploying models using Fast API, Flask, or Lambda functions.
- Familiarity with AWS Bedrock, SageMaker
- Prior work in eCommerce, digital publishing, or online content platforms.
- Knowledge of observability, logging, and profiling tools for ML systems Notice Period
- 1 Month or less Interested candidates can visit us at Eastern Book Company (EBC), 34 Lalbagh, Near Hazratganj Metro Station Gate No. 2, Lucknow- 226001.
Resume not ready?
Build an ATS-friendly resume tailored to this role in minutes — for free.
Build resume→Source: LinkedIn